On 12/4/23 02:31, Borislav Petkov wrote:
> On Fri, Dec 01, 2023 at 03:24:52PM -0800, Alexey Makhalov wrote:
>> +#ifdef CONFIG_INTEL_TDX_GUEST
>> +/* __tdx_hypercall() is not exported. So, export the wrapper */
>> +void vmware_tdx_hypercall_args(struct tdx_module_args *args)
>> +{
>> +	__tdx_hypercall(args);
>> +}
>> +E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(vmware_tdx_hypercall_args);
> Uuuh, lovely. I'd like to see what the TDX folks think about this
> export first.

I don't really like it much.  This does a generic thing (make a TDX
hypercall) with a specific name ("vmware_").  If you want to make an
argument that a certain chunk of the __tdx_hypercall() space is just for
VMWare and you also add a VMWare-specific check and then export *that*,
it might be acceptable.

But I don't want random modules able to make random, unrestricted TDX
hypercalls.  That's asking for trouble.
